In our fast-paced society many people experience problems with digesting all the sensory information that they encounter on a daily basis. Consequently they feel stuck or blocked, and find it hard to focus and rest.

 

While practicing yoga improves physical fitness, flexibility and balance it also helps to reduce stress, depression, and anxiety.

 

My teaching blends an alignment-based flow practice with Kundalini and yin yoga sequences to enhance and balance the flow of energy in the meridian and organ systems. Meditation and breath practice are integrated to help remove mental and emotional tension. All these aspects help us bring together the elements within ourselves that often get fragmented in our everyday busy lives.

 

Practicing yoga together with others is about having fun instead of competing with each other. We open our hearts and create more space in our bodies and minds, so that we feel balanced and light, yet grounded.

prenatal yoga

A prenatal yoga practice can be assumed after the third month of pregnancy

and allows you to slow down and focus attention on what is going on your body.

 

As circulation is enhanced within the joints and the muscles are elongated, swelling decreases and the immune system is strengthened.

Breath-work helps to release physical, emotional and mental tension and is a good preparatory tool for labour during contractions.
